IP查询
查询
你查询的IP:[117.32.132.131] 地理位置:中国–陕西–西安
最新查询
123.196.3.248
121.56.118.237
116.252.35.201
121.4.207.84
123.253.51.93
123.232.80.207
203.93.221.165
114.80.139.120
123.130.128.161
117.32.132.131
124.28.192.180
116.2.141.8
116.76.88.170
203.86.64.79
202.164.210.14
124.240.128.208
202.124.24.153
121.51.219.80
58.24.71.240
60.235.246.217
122.152.192.101
124.88.121.170
119.62.163.43
123.8.56.242
221.196.189.37
221.12.128.159
222.32.243.250
124.172.131.2
120.30.242.168
221.12.190.133
118.228.53.145